How do I use LightUp in SketchUp?
After downloading it, open up the file in SketchUp and open the LightUp preferences dialog. By default, LightUp preferences for a model will be “Direct Sources” and a lighting Resolution of “4x”. You can see “Use Sun” is checked which means LightUp will be using the sun position as defined by SketchUp.

How do you make something glow in SketchUp?
Select the texture on the screen using the pickup tool. You will see it in the albedo section of the Enscape Materials Editor. Just enable Self Illumination, and the screen will glow.

How do you add lights in SketchUp Twilight?
Basic Lighting
- Click the Twilight Render Light Tool button in the toolbar.
- The editor window will open.
- Using the Light Tool, click in your scene where you want the light to be anchored.
- Next, click where you want the light to be positioned.
- Finally, click where you want the light to point, or target.
How do I add Enscape to lights in SketchUp?
To place a light source from within SketchUp, select Extensions -> Enscape -> Enscape Objects, or click the same command on the Enscape toolbar, as shown in the image below. The Enscape Objects dialog appears. From here, you can place new objects and edit the previously placed ones.
